I like this card.

EVGA 512-P3-N862-AR GeForce 9600GT Superclocked 512MB 256-bit GDDR3 PCI Express 2.0 x16 HDCP Ready SLI Supported Video Card
EVGA 512-P3-N862-AR GeForce 9600GT Superclocked 512MB 256-bit GDDR3 PCI Express 2.0 x16 HDCP Ready SLI Supported Video Card

Pros: CHEAP, FAST, THIN, not power hog.

Cons: not as good as the 8800gt, but the gt is $240 so im not that mad.

Overall Review: I was testing company of heroes, with one card. I got an average of 59.9 fps, a high of 61fps, and a low of 7fps on the testwith everything on high or ultra except no AA. When I did the test with 2 cards, I got 60 as an average, 61 as a high and 27 as the lowest with the same settings. The I upped the texture detail to max and anti aliasing to 16x and I got the exact same FPS. The second card doesn’t push the fps up, just reinforces the one you have, making the speeds you’re getting possible at a higher setting. for around 300 you can perform like a gts but for 100 bucks less.
